PRIMARY outcome

Timeframe: 15 to 42 days

Population: For 1 subject evaluation was not possible due to complete necrosis of the injected lesion

The total T-cell level was measured at baseline and end of Step 1. Change from baseline was listed as absolute change. Data cannot be presented on subject-level and are therefore presented as the arithmetic mean value for the factor increase (+) or decrease (-) in number of cells/mm2 from baseline to end of Step 1.

Outcome measures

Outcome measures
Measure
LTX-315 plus TIL infusion
n=5 Participants
LTX-315 intratumoural injection, TILs expansion and infusion. LTX-315 and TILs: Intratumoural injection of LTX-315 and infusion of TILs
Change in Total T-cell Level in Tumour Tissues From Baseline (Step 1, Week 1, Day 1) to End of Step 1 (Step 1, Week 3-5)
1.9 factor change in cells/mm2
Interval -0.6 to 6.9

PRIMARY outcome

Timeframe: Up to 133 days

Population: AEs related to LTX-315 treatment were evaluated for the 6 subjects completing Step 1. AEs related to LTX-315 treatment in combination with adoptive T-cell therapy were evaluated for the 4 subjects completing Step 2.

AEs were events occurring during or after administration of the IMP. AEs were coded using MedDRA version 21.1 and were classified by System Organ Class (SOC), Preferred Term (PT) and Lowest Level Term (LLT). Adverse events related to LTX-315 were events where causality to LTX-315 was marked on the adverse events page. Adverse events related to the combination of LTX-315 and adoptive T-cell therapy were events where both causality to LTX-315 and at least one of the other IMPs (TILs, Sendoxan®, Fludara® and Proleukin®) were marked on the adverse event page.

Outcome measures

Outcome measures
Measure
LTX-315 plus TIL infusion
n=6 Participants
LTX-315 intratumoural injection, TILs expansion and infusion. LTX-315 and TILs: Intratumoural injection of LTX-315 and infusion of TILs
Adverse Events (AE) Related to LTX-315 or to the Combination of LTX-315 and Adoptive T-cell Therapy From Baseline (Step 1, Week 1, Day 1) to End of Treatment (EoT) (Step 2, Week 7)
AEs related to LTX-315 treatment during Step 1.
14 events
Adverse Events (AE) Related to LTX-315 or to the Combination of LTX-315 and Adoptive T-cell Therapy From Baseline (Step 1, Week 1, Day 1) to End of Treatment (EoT) (Step 2, Week 7)
AEs related to LTX-315 treatment in combination with adoptive T-cell therapy during Step 2
0 events

SECONDARY outcome

Timeframe: EoT (Step 2, Week 7) and up to 15 months after EoT.

Population: ORR was evaluated for the 4 subjects who progressed to Step 2.

Per Response Evaluation Criteria In Solid Tumors Criteria (RECIST v1.0) for target lesions and assessed by CT/MRI: Complete Response (CR), Disappearance of all target lesions; Partial Response (PR), \>=30% decrease in the sum of the longest diameter of target lesions; Overall Response (OR) = CR + PR.

Outcome measures

Outcome measures
Measure
LTX-315 plus TIL infusion
n=4 Participants
LTX-315 intratumoural injection, TILs expansion and infusion. LTX-315 and TILs: Intratumoural injection of LTX-315 and infusion of TILs
Objective Response Rate
ORR at EoT (Step 2, Week 7)
0 participants
Objective Response Rate
ORR at up tp 15 months after EoT
0 participants

SECONDARY outcome

Timeframe: Days from screening (Baseline) until date of progressive disease or up to 15 months after EoT.

Population: Endpoint evaluated for the 4 subjects who progressed to Step 2.

Progression is defined using Response Evaluation Criteria In Solid Tumors Criteria (RECIST v1.0), as a 20% increase in the sum of the longest diameter of target lesions, or a measurable increase in a non-target lesion, or the appearance of new lesions.

Outcome measures

Outcome measures
Measure
LTX-315 plus TIL infusion
n=4 Participants
LTX-315 intratumoural injection, TILs expansion and infusion. LTX-315 and TILs: Intratumoural injection of LTX-315 and infusion of TILs
Progression Free Survival
153 days
Interval 72.0 to 208.0
